BRIEFING — Leadership Review: Possible Acquisition of Quillhaven Analytics

For: Branch Managers

Halloway Group is evaluating the purchase of Quillhaven Analytics, a forecasting-tools vendor. Due diligence is underway; no agreement is signed. The fit is with our mid-market reporting line, where we currently resell third-party tools. Headcount impact at branch level is expected to be minimal. Do not discuss with customers or press. Rationale and timing considerations are set out below.

board note of kageg-bahof: The renewal with Holwynax Holdings closes at $2 million a year, 5 percent below the last contract. Project Ulaath slips by two quarters because of the supplier delay.

# Catalogue import service for the Marrowgate Public Library system.
# This env file configures the nightly MARC record sync from the Ferndell
# consortium feed into our local Shelfwright index. Reviewers: note that
# IMPORT_BATCH_SIZE was lowered to 200 after the March timeout incidents,
# and DEDUP_MODE must stay set to "strict" or duplicate holdings reappear.
# Everything above this point is non-sensitive and may be committed to the
# sample file. The consortium feed requires an access credential, and the
# next line sets it.

env line for fafof-fahag: LEDGER_TOKEN5=f8790

# Break-Glass: Catalog Cache Invalidation

Scope: the Pinrow product catalog at Veldstone Retail. If stale prices persist after a purge and the Hollowmere invalidation queue is wedged, use break-glass to flush the edge tier directly. Contractors: get verbal sign-off from the catalog lead first. Steps: open the Hollowmere admin shell, select emergency-flush, confirm the tenant, and run it once — repeated flushes thrash the origin. Access is logged and expires after 20 minutes. Unseal the admin shell with the passphrase below.

recovery phrase for kahop-tajog: istix-casvan